HARDY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L
Hardy Elementary School is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Hamilton County school district, located in Chattanooga, TN with about 470 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to 5th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 30 teachers, Hardy Elementary School has a student/teacher ratio of about 15: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 470 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ending HARDY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ly Black or African American, representing about 94% of the student body.
